/**
* The DOOM lighting model applies a light level delta to everything when
* e.g. the player shoots.
*
* @return Calculated delta.
*/
float Rend_ExtraLightDelta();
void Rend_ApplyTorchLight(float *color3, float distance);
void Rend_ApplyTorchLight(de::Vector4f &color, float distance);
/**
* Apply range compression delta to @a lightValue.
* @param lightValue The light level value to apply adaptation to.
*/
void Rend_ApplyLightAdaptation(float &lightValue);
/// Same as Rend_ApplyLightAdaptation except the delta is returned.
float Rend_LightAdaptationDelta(float lightvalue);
/**
* The DOOM lighting model applies distance attenuation to sector light
* levels.
*
* @param distToViewer Distance from the viewer to this object.
* @param lightLevel Sector lightLevel at this object's origin.
* @return The specified lightLevel plus any attentuation.
*/
float Rend_AttenuateLightLevel(float distToViewer, float lightLevel);
float Rend_ShadowAttenuationFactor(coord_t distance);
/**
* Updates the lightModRange which is used to applify sector light to help
* compensate for the differences between the OpenGL lighting equation,
* the software Doom lighting model and the light grid (ambient lighting).
*
* The offsets in the lightRangeModTables are added to the sector->lightLevel
* during rendering (both positive and negative).
*/
void Rend_UpdateLightModMatrix();
/**
* Draws the lightModRange (for debug)
*/
void Rend_DrawLightModMatrix();
